規格
| 屬性 | 價值 |
| Package | Bulk |
| Series | AVR® ATmega |
| ProductStatus | Active |
| CoreProcessor | AVR |
| CoreSize | 8-Bit |
| Speed | 20MHz |
| Connectivity | I²C, SPI, UART/USART |
| Peripherals | Brown-out Detect/Reset, POR, PWM, WDT |
| NumberofI/O | 23 |
| ProgramMemorySize | 4KB (2K x 16) |
| ProgramMemoryType | FLASH |
| EEPROMSize | 256 x 8 |
| RAMSize | 512 x 8 |
| Voltage-Supply(Vcc/Vdd) | 1.8V ~ 5.5V |
| DataConverters | A/D 8x10b |
| OscillatorType | Internal |
| OperatingTemperature | -40°C ~ 85°C (TA) |
| MountingType | Surface Mount |
| Package/Case | 32-VFQFN Exposed Pad |

Equivalent
Equivalent products to the ATMEGA48PA-MU include:
- ATMEGA48PA-AU (TQFP package)
- ATMEGA48P-MU (slightly older revision)
- ATMEGA88PA-MU (higher flash memory)
- ATMEGA168PA-MU (double the flash/RAM)
- ATTINY48-MU (lower-cost alternative with fewer features).
All are 8-bit AVR microcontrollers with similar pinouts and peripherals, varying in memory, package, or minor revisions. Check datasheets for exact compatibility.

Features
The ATmega48PA-MU is an 8-bit AVR microcontroller with these key features:
- Core: 8-bit AVR, up to 20 MHz clock speed.
- Memory: 4 KB Flash, 512 B SRAM, 256 B EEPROM.
- I/O Pins: 23 programmable I/O lines.
- Peripherals:
- 6-channel 10-bit ADC
- 3 timers (2x 8-bit, 1x 16-bit)
- USART, SPI, I²C (TWI)
- Watchdog timer, analog comparator
- Power: 1.8V–5.5V operation, low-power modes.
- Package: 32-pad QFN (5x5mm).
- Debugging: On-chip debugWIRE interface.
Ideal for embedded control, IoT, and low-power applications.

Manufacturer
The ATMEGA48PA-MU is manufactured by Microchip Technology, a leading American semiconductor company known for its microcontrollers, analog, and Flash-IP solutions.
Microchip, founded in 1989 and headquartered in Chandler, Arizona, specializes in embedded control systems, serving industries like automotive, industrial, consumer electronics, and IoT. It acquired Atmel in 2016, inheriting the popular ATmega series, including the ATMEGA48PA-MU, an 8-bit AVR microcontroller.
The company is recognized for reliability, innovation, and a broad product portfolio, making it a key player in the semiconductor market.

Package
The ATMEGA48PA-MU comes in a QFN (Quad Flat No-leads) package, specifically MLF (Micro Lead Frame) 32-pin. It measures 5mm x 5mm with a 0.5mm pitch. This compact, surface-mount package is ideal for space-constrained applications, offering good thermal and electrical performance. The "MU" suffix denotes the QFN/MLF package type.
